Lightbridge to Hold Business Update & Third Quarter 2025 Earnings Conference Call on Thursday, November 6 at 4 p.m. ET

RESTON, Va., Oct. 21, 2025 ( GLOBE NEWSWIRE ) -- Lightbridge Corporation ( "Lightbridge" or the "Company" ) ( Nasdaq: LTBR ) , an advanced nuclear fuel technology company, will announce its financial results for the third quarter of fiscal year 2025 on Wednesday, November 5, after the market ...

TRISO approval, HALEU pact advance US nuclear fuel

Framatome said the US NRC approved a licence amendment raising enrichment at materials licence SNM-1227 from 6.5 wt% U-235 to under 10% and authorising TRISO fuel fabrication at its Richland site. The approval supports Standard Nuclear-Framatome’s plan to start UO2 powder and TRISO particle manufacturing in 2027. Separate MoUs cover HALEU supply talks between Lightbridge and QNI.

Pentagon to invest $400m in Australian rare earth mine

Sunrise Energy Metals said the US Pentagon will provide a conditional $400 million loan commitment to develop Syerston, a proposed scandium mine in Fifield, NSW. The project targets Western supply of scandium used in defence and other sectors amid China’s export restrictions. Sunrise also said it has a deal with Lockheed Martin for 25% of output for five years.

Trump administration to invest $3 billion in minerals projects to boost US defence supply chains

President Trump said the US will invest $3 billion in critical minerals and battery projects to expand domestic supply chains for national security. He announced Defence Department Office of Strategic Capital conditional loans totaling $1.4B to Sila Nanotechnologies, $400M to Sunrise Energy Metals, and $150M to Niron Magnetics, plus $58M Export-Import Bank loans. The plan also includes $100M in mining-school grants and $80M for three schools.

Nvidia to invest up to US$3 billion in Stargate data centre developer Lancium: The Information

Nvidia plans to invest up to $3 billion in Lancium, the developer of the Stargate data center campus in Texas, The Information reported. Nvidia would invest $2 billion for about a 20% stake, with an additional $1 billion possible based on grid hookup thresholds. Lancium’s land and power portfolio has an enterprise value near $10 billion, and it may explore an IPO in 2027.
